## Schema Registry Basics

All events flowing through the Pellwick pipeline must have a schema registered in Brimcat before producers can publish. The registry enforces backward compatibility by default; breaking changes require a new subject version and sign-off from the data platform rotation. If you're paged for schema validation failures, check the rejected-events queue first — most incidents are producers skipping registration. Full registration steps and compatibility rules are documented on the internal page below.

wiki page, hahif-hahif: https://argocd.kelvisys.corp/browse/board/settings/pages/1442e0b1065d83f1

Action item: The Relayn deploy-status bot silently dropped updates when the pipeline API paginated results, so responders believed a rollback had completed when it had not. We will add pagination handling, a staleness banner, and an integration test. Until merged, verify deploy state directly in the pipeline console, documented at the page below.

runbook for kahop-kajop: https://rundeck.ordinio.test/display/secrets/pipeline/issue/pages/repo/browse/e5732776e07d1285107e5aeb

# Break-Glass: Cobaltworks Billing Worker

Blue-green deploys via `shiftctl`. Green takes traffic only after the ledger replay check passes. Rollback: repoint the alias to blue; never redeploy under incident. Break-glass applies when both environments are wedged and the deploy vault is sealed. Unseal it with the recovery passphrase recorded immediately below.

strongbox words: zorwyn-sorael-belion-ulaius-silmir-ulays-briax-rusdor-gorix

Capacity note for the Bramblewick export retry queue. Failed exports are requeued with exponential backoff, and the queue depth is our main capacity signal: sustained depth above the high-water mark means downstream Pellis storage is saturated, not that we need more workers. As the new contractor, please don't raise worker counts without checking storage latency first — it usually makes things worse. Retry timing, backoff caps, and the high-water threshold are all driven by the constants shown below.

limits module of yagef-bajog:
TIERS = {
    "druael": 370,
    "tamix": 286,
    "pelius": 541,
    "pelael": 78,
    "pelox": 47,
    "ralath": 533,
    "drumir": 801,
}